URGENT UPDATE: Chicago police are intensifying their search for 1-year-old Amarion Braggs and 18-year-old Angelina Braggs, who have been missing since October 11, 2023. The two were last seen in the 2700 block of South Dearborn Street in the Douglass neighborhood, and concerns are mounting as they have been unaccounted for for nearly a month.
Authorities report that it remains unclear whether Amarion and Angelina are related or if they disappeared simultaneously. The police have disclosed that both individuals may require medical attention, heightening the urgency of their safe return.
Angelina was last spotted wearing a black tank top, black jacket, blue jeans, and Crocs. Unfortunately, police have not released a description of Amarion from the day he went missing, which adds to the challenges of locating him.
